Output 76c0b43908620665b492ea101d61f0fce1fa68d1de493c6014a8a111d2abf250:1

value
1059382094
script pubkey
OP_0 OP_PUSHBYTES_20 ddd90b9f2b640b83834b1fd5b1239fa2e78b7d6f
address
ltc1qmhvsh8etvs9c8q6trl2mzgul5tncklt0wjmh90
transaction
76c0b43908620665b492ea101d61f0fce1fa68d1de493c6014a8a111d2abf250
spent
true